Ingredients
8 pieces of Cannelloni pasta
200 g minced meat (mix)
250 g tomato sauce
50 g butter
1 onion
1 teaspoon fresh oregano leaves
8 slices Mozzarella cheese (or 100 g Gouda)
a pinch - two salt and pepper
olive oil
Method
Fry in olive oil chopped onions on small cubes, than add the minced meat.
Fry meat until it catches the color. Add salt, pepper, oregano, and about three tablespoons of tomato sauce. Set aside to cool slightly.
Fill the cannelloni with minced meat (do not squeeze meat too much, otherwise it would be too hard).
Baking dish brush with a little olive oil, cover the bottom with half the tomato sauce and arrange Cannelloni next to each other. It is extremely important that you not arranged Cannelloni one of top of other because the pasta will stick.
The rest of the tomato sauce, pour over the top of Cannelloni making sure that they are good cover, otherwise it will remain hard.
On tomato sauce arrange slices of mozzarella or grated Gouda and chopped butter leaves.
Bake in a pre-heated oven for about 30 minutes at 180°C.
